For the 2025 school year, there are 2 private schools serving 55 students in 27260, NC (there are 7 public schools, serving 2,715 public students). 2% of all K-12 students in 27260, NC are educated in private schools (compared to the NC state average of 8%).
100% of private schools in 27260, NC are religiously affiliated (most commonly Seventh Day Adventist and Pentecostal).
